Many interesting opportunities lie within the field of data sharing:

  • Mobility: E.g., combining data from urban planners, public transport companies, CO2 reports, …
  • Health: E.g., improving algorithms for early detection of cancer by training them on data not just from one, but multiple hospitals.
  • … and many more domains.

While data is massively produced everywhere and everyday, currently, appropriate infrastructure to share such data and knowledge is lacking. Solutions must consider a variety of aspects, such as data integration, privacy, sovereignty, semantics, trustworthiness, and incentivization.

Our use case within the Cluster of Excellence project “Internet of Production” is in the domain of supply chain management. We research how to support companies in building resilient and sustainable supply chain partnerships. Our approach is to build a partner recommendation system through combining data and information from multiple stakeholders.
